So we all know that Chaz needs the blood of the innocent to be powered up and the blood only has to be innocent from a certain point of view. Chaz didn't get charged up by Alt-Aylees blood, and didn't seem to get charged up by DoP demon blood (though failed to cut them without being charged up, but it's probably a safe assumption their blood wouldn't work). So Alien blood don't seem to work, even those which might be regarded as innocent from a certain point of view.

My speculation is that what really powers Chaz up is simply human blood, with the possible exception of the bearer of Chaz. Is there any strip which contradicts this theory? Contradictions would be Chaz failing to get charged by human blood, or to a lesser degree, Chaz getting charged by something that is genetically unrelated to humans.

It would appear that anything with blood can be judged to be innocent.

Aylee's species innately wants to devour other species, so definitely not innocent. Being an alien does not have any bearing on it. Now for demons, I'm not so sure. Are they automatically evil just because they are demons, or is it more like humans and what they do (or do not do) in demon society determines whether they are not innocent?

As for Oasis, Kusari/Sasha, their bodies are merely vessels for a soul that appears to merely control the body but not inhabit it. So their non-innocent actions don't "taint" the bodies' blood. Also, but for opposite reasons, the squid-on-a-stick is used to commit atrocities but is not willing participant.

Getting back to the original topic. We are essentially trying to prove a negative. If Chaz powers up, then the blood is "innocent". If Chaz does not power up...well, we assume they were not innocent, but how do we know for sure? We have not seen anyone where we knew without a possibility of a doubt that they were 100% innocent. Nor do we know at what point the cut-off is for Chaz's innocent's meter.

Of course, we also don't know if Chaz could be lying about all of this. Chaz has shown that it can willfully be powered but not show any signs of that fact. So for all we know, Chaz could be powered by any blood but chooses not to show it at all times. And only when visually powered up, can Chaz kill everything.
